Rumor: new iMacs in October, including Retina display

O DigiTimes it is far from being a reliable vehicle, such as the WSJ, but once in a while asians get it right, which is exactly why it’s worth noting the last of them. According to the site, Apple is preparing to launch new iMacs in October, with mass production starting this month.

Two iMacs

Supply chain sources also said that the new iMacs have a great chance of coming equipped with Retina screens, after all, Apple extends the novelty to the entire line of Mac products, being just a matter of time until all computers have the displays high resolution. The design of the machine would remain the same, however Apple would be planning a renewal of it (and the Mac Pro) for 2013.
